- 博客(1)
- 收藏
- 关注
原创 内核模式驱动不推荐使用C++的缘由
本文所讲内容主要源自Windows DDK文档。一、内存页面交换和用户模式程序不同,内存页面交换对内核模式的代码不是透明的,而是需要一定程度的主动管理,要保证在代码执行过程中不会需要载入新的页面。编译器有相关的扩展#pragma指令来帮助C代码显式控制生成的二进制代码布局,以便相关的代码被放在一起,被调用时只需载入最少的页面。而对C++而言,还存在一些编译器自动生成的代码块和数
2013-12-03 13:36:40 3907
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人